Common questions
Is A Discovery of Witches a romance?
Yes. A Discovery of Witches centers on a forbidden romance between a closet witch named Diana Bishop and a centuries-old vampire named Matthew Clairmont. Their relationship develops alongside a deadly mystery that begins when a magical book is discovered in an Oxford library.
What is the central mystery in A Discovery of Witches?
The central mystery in A Discovery of Witches revolves around the appearance of a magical book in an Oxford library. This discovery draws the two protagonists, Diana Bishop and Matthew Clairmont, into a dangerous situation that challenges the boundaries of their respective worlds.
Who are the main characters in A Discovery of Witches?
The main characters in A Discovery of Witches are Diana Bishop, who is a closet witch, and Matthew Clairmont, a vampire who has lived for centuries. Their paths cross at an Oxford library, leading them into a complex mystery and a forbidden romantic entanglement.
